摘要
Based on the special transform of graphics, the general mathematical geometric models of different wire ropes with defined initial parameters are presented. On this basis, the geometric model of IWRC6*36WS wire rope is set up by using Matlab and Pro/E. Abaqus/Explicit is used to analyze the elastic property of the wire rope under axial tension. The simulation analysis results show that the nonlinear relationship between the axial tension and the axial elongation of the wire rope is obvious.
